J. Stephen Morrison, a veteran diplomat, noted Africanist, and expert on international public health, has been appointed as the next James R. Schlesinger Distinguished Professor at the Miller Center.

On behalf of the Governing Council of the University of Virginia’s Miller Center—a non-partisan institute specializing in the presidency and public policy—we speak in opposition to the ugly incidents of racism, hate, and violence that assaulted Charlottesville and the University.

Marc Short, White House director of legislative and intergovernmental affairs and assistant to President Donald J. Trump, is joining the nonpartisan Miller Center for Public Affairs at the University of Virginia as a senior fellow, effective August 1.
